How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Bluff Springs?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Bluff Springs Studio Apartments | $1,304 | $830 | $1,894 |
Bluff Springs 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,417 | $470 | $4,795 |
Bluff Springs 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,842 | $989 | $4,788 |
Bluff Springs 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,076 | $800 | $5,899 |
Bluff Springs 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,999 | $1,799 | $2,445 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Gated Bluff Springs Apartments
What is the Cheapest Gated apartment in Bluff Springs?
Currently the most affordable Gated Apartment in Bluff Springs is at Terra Apartments listed at $859.
How much is the average rent for a Gated Bluff Springs Apartment?
The average rent for a Gated Apartment in Bluff Springs is $1,918.
What is the largest Gated Bluff Springs Apartment for rent?
Today's Gated apartment with the most square footage in Bluff Springs is a 1,721 square feet unit starting from $1,234 at Bexley SoCo.
What is the average size for Bluff Springs Gated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Gated rental in Bluff Springs is currently at 648 sq ft.
